All About the Books of the Bible for Kids

The All About the Books of the Bible Lapbook is a fun, hands-on study of the Bible for your child from the ages of 5-12. You and your child will study several aspects of the structure of the Bible:

  • Vocabulary Definitions of Bible Genres and Categories
  • The Genres of the Old and New Testaments
  • The Books of the Bible in Order
  • Author, Date Written, Genre, and Theme of Each Book of the Bible

It is important that our kids know the books of the Bible so that they can find their way around the “library” of the Bible, but it’s also important that they learn about each book of the Bible. These facts will help your child read the Bible with a greater level of comfort, knowledge, and understanding.

Supplies You’ll Need for Your All About the Books of the Bible Lapbook

You’ll need a few supplies to put together your lapbook. You probably already have most of these. If not, it’s worth investing in them as you will use them again and again with your kids.

  • A Colored File Folder
  • A Sheet of Cardstock in a Complimentary Color
  • Printer Paper
  • Scissors
  • A Glue Stick
  • Thin Ribbon
  • A Stapler
  • Colored Pens to Write With
  • Colored Pencils to Color With

How to Print and Use the Books of the Bible Lapbook

To create the base of your lapbook, place your file folder on a table and fold both sides inward toward the creased spine of the folder. Once the outer edges meet, crease your file folder. This will give you a book that opens in the middle. You will still have a fold in the middle of your book, so I like to glue a piece of cardstock into the middle section of the book to create a thick center that won’t bend.

All About the Books of the Bible Lapbook
You’ll want to print the All About the Books of the Bible Lapbook single-sided on plain printer paper using color ink. In your lapbook pages, you will find step-by-step instructions on each minibook and activity, explaining how to assemble each.
